Rounding Rule Information for Providers of Section 25, Dental Services

On May 29, 2022, MaineCare adopted changes to the rounding rule in Chapter I, Section 1.03-8(J), effective January 1, 2023, which the Department will not enforce until May 1, 2023. MaineCare provided a future effective date and delayed enforcement of the rule to give providers time to make necessary system changes to bill for partial units of service.

The rounding rule applies to all units of service that are measured in minutes, which means it affects Section 25 providers billing for anesthesia services and behavior management.

Providers that cannot make the necessary system changes to bill for partial units by May 1, 2023, may submit claims with partial units through direct data entry on the Health PAS Online Portal. Effective April 1, 2023, MaineCare  made changes to the Portal so that it will accept partial units in the quantity box for dental claims.
